AI can be broadly defined as the simulation of human intelligence in machines that are programmed to think like humans and mimic their actions. This includes learning, reasoning, problem-solving, perception, language understanding, and more. The primary goal of AI research is to create systems that can function intelligently and independently, ultimately enhancing human capabilities and efficiency.
One of the most exciting aspects of AI is its versatility. It has applications across numerous sectors, including healthcare, finance, education, transportation, and entertainment. In healthcare, for instance, AI is revolutionizing diagnostics. Machine learning algorithms can analyze medical images with incredible accuracy, helping radiologists detect conditions such as tumors in their infancy. AI can also assist in drug discovery, predicting how different compounds will react in the human body, thereby accelerating the development of new medications.
In finance, AI is driving innovations in risk assessment and fraud detection. By analyzing vast amounts of transaction data, AI systems can identify patterns that might indicate fraudulent activity, allowing financial institutions to take preventive measures swiftly. Furthermore, AI-powered chatbots are enhancing customer service by providing users with instant support and personalized financial advice.
Education is yet another field benefiting from AI technologies. Adaptive learning systems powered by AI can tailor educational experiences to individual students’ needs, adjusting content based on their strengths and weaknesses. This personalized approach to learning not only boosts student engagement but also improves overall educational outcomes.
Transportation is witnessing a radical transformation with the advent of autonomous vehicles. Companies like Tesla, Waymo, and others are at the forefront of this innovation, utilizing AI to develop self-driving cars that can navigate complex road conditions with minimal human input. This technology promises to increase road safety, reduce traffic congestion, and enhance accessibility for individuals unable to drive.
Entertainment is also being reshaped by AI. From recommendation algorithms used by streaming services to the creation of entirely new content, such as music and art, AI’s influence is pervasive. For example, platforms like Netflix employ AI to analyze viewing habits, suggesting content tailored to individual tastes and preferences, making the user experience more enjoyable and personalized.
While the benefits of AI are evident, the technology also poses a number of challenges and ethical considerations. One major concern is the potential for job displacement. As AI systems become more capable, there is a valid fear that they will replace human workers in various sectors. This disruption could lead to significant economic shifts, necessitating a reevaluation of workforce training and education to help individuals transition into new roles.
Privacy is another critical issue that stems from the widespread use of AI. With the vast amounts of data required to train AI models, concerns about data security and personal privacy are paramount. Instances of data breaches and misuse of information have raised alarms, prompting discussions around the need for stricter regulations and ethical guidelines for AI development and implementation.
Moreover, there is the risk of bias in AI systems. If the data used to train these models is not representative of the broader population, the outcomes can be skewed, leading to unfair treatment of certain groups. Addressing this issue requires a concerted effort to ensure diversity in data collection and to implement fair algorithms that promote equity.

Why are software updates important for Android devices?
Software updates provide security patches, improve performance, and add new features, enhancing the overall user experience.
How often should Android devices receive updates?
Ideally, devices should receive updates at least once every few months, though this can vary by manufacturer.
Do software updates affect the resale value of Android devices?
Yes, devices that regularly receive updates tend to have a higher resale value due to better performance and security.
What happens if I don’t update my Android device?
Neglecting updates can expose your device to security vulnerabilities and degrade performance over time.
Can software updates change the user interface of my device?
Yes, updates may introduce changes to the user interface or new features, altering how you interact with the device.
